+// This implementation of bit_cast is different from the C++17 one in two ways:
+// - It isn't constexpr because that requires compiler support.
+// - It requires trivially-constructible To, to avoid UB in the implementation.
+template <typename To, typename From
+ , typename = typename std::enable_if<sizeof(To) == sizeof(From)>::type
+#if (__has_feature(is_trivially_constructible) && defined(_LIBCPP_VERSION)) || \
+ (defined(__GNUC__) && __GNUC__ >= 5)
+ , typename = typename std::is_trivially_constructible<To>::type
+#elif __has_feature(is_trivially_constructible)
+ , typename = typename std::enable_if<__is_trivially_constructible(To)>::type
+#else
+ // See comment below.
+#endif
+#if (__has_feature(is_trivially_copyable) && defined(_LIBCPP_VERSION)) || \
+ (defined(__GNUC__) && __GNUC__ >= 5)
+ , typename = typename std::enable_if<std::is_trivially_copyable<To>::value>::type
+ , typename = typename std::enable_if<std::is_trivially_copyable<From>::value>::type
+#elif __has_feature(is_trivially_copyable)
+ , typename = typename std::enable_if<__is_trivially_copyable(To)>::type
+ , typename = typename std::enable_if<__is_trivially_copyable(From)>::type
+#else
+// This case is GCC 4.x. clang with libc++ or libstdc++ never get here. Unlike
+// llvm/Support/type_traits.h's is_trivially_copyable we don't want to
+// provide a good-enough answer here: developers in that configuration will hit
+// compilation failures on the bots instead of locally. That's acceptable
+// because it's very few developers, and only until we move past C++11.
+#endif
+>
+inline To bit_cast(const From &from) noexcept {
+ To to;
+ std::memcpy(&to, &from, sizeof(To));
+ return to;
+}
